Output e4dc22cb3f655dca8675797cbcb2007fbe9cf8b984efd651c7cfded8ec44eeea:0

value
27917736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20d527388dcaa7f5a0219ab1d6e0a895bca68f69 OP_EQUALVERIFY OP_CHECKSIG
address
13zbyHR4PFN943wrNnDVX3pUWwDyNjtZok
transaction
e4dc22cb3f655dca8675797cbcb2007fbe9cf8b984efd651c7cfded8ec44eeea
confirmations
508383
spent
true